当前位置:首页 > 学习方法 > 正文内容

html中颜色代码,HTML颜色代码全解析

wzgly1个月前 (07-28)学习方法1
HTML中的颜色代码通常用于设置文本、背景或其他元素的色彩,这些代码可以采用多种格式:,1. **十六进制代码**:以#开头,后面跟随6个十六进制数字(如#FF0000代表红色)。,2. **RGB代码**:以rgb()函数包裹,如rgb(255, 0, 0)也是红色。,3. **RGBA代码**:与RGB类似,但增加了alpha通道,用于设置透明度,如rgba(255, 0, 0, 0.5)。,4. **预定义颜色名称**:如redblue等,可直接在CSS中使用。,在HTML和CSS中,正确使用颜色代码,可以让网页设计更加丰富多彩。

用户提问:我想在HTML中设置一些颜色,但是不知道颜色代码是什么,能帮忙解释一下吗?

解答:当然可以!在HTML中设置颜色,主要就是通过颜色代码来实现的,颜色代码可以告诉浏览器你想要显示的颜色是什么,下面我会从几个方面来详细解释一下。

一:颜色代码的类型

  1. 十六进制颜色代码:这是最常见的一种颜色代码格式,通常以“#”开头,后面跟着六位十六进制数字,黑色可以表示为#000000,白色可以表示为#FFFFFF
  2. RGB颜色代码:RGB颜色代码由三个数字组成,分别代表红色(Red)、绿色(Green)和蓝色(Blue),每个颜色通道的值范围从0到255,红色可以表示为rgb(255, 0, 0)
  3. 颜色名称:HTML还支持一些颜色名称,如redbluegreen等,这些名称可以直接在CSS中使用,无需转换。

二:颜色代码的应用

  1. 背景颜色:在HTML中,你可以通过background-color属性来设置元素的背景颜色。<div style="background-color: #FF0000;">这是一个红色的div</div>
  2. 文本颜色:使用color属性可以设置文本的颜色。<p style="color: #00FF00;">这是绿色的文本</p>
  3. 边框颜色border-color属性可以用来设置元素的边框颜色。<div style="border: 2px solid #0000FF;">这是一个蓝色边框的div</div>

三:颜色代码的转换

  1. 十六进制到RGB:将十六进制颜色代码转换为RGB颜色代码非常简单,只需将十六进制数字分成三组,每组代表一个颜色通道的值即可。#FF0000转换为RGB就是rgb(255, 0, 0)
  2. RGB到十六进制:将RGB颜色代码转换为十六进制颜色代码,需要将每个颜色通道的值转换为对应的十六进制数字。rgb(255, 0, 0)转换为十六进制就是#FF0000
  3. 颜色名称到代码:大多数颜色名称都可以直接在CSS中使用,无需转换,如果你需要将颜色名称转换为十六进制或RGB代码,可以使用在线工具或编程库来完成。

四:颜色代码的预定义

  1. 标准颜色:HTML定义了一系列标准颜色名称,如redbluegreen等,这些颜色名称可以直接在CSS中使用。
  2. Web安全色:Web安全色是一组在所有浏览器和设备上都能正确显示的颜色,共有216种,这些颜色可以通过RGB或十六进制代码来表示。
  3. 自定义颜色:除了标准颜色和Web安全色,你还可以自定义颜色,通过十六进制、RGB或颜色名称来实现。

五:颜色代码的兼容性

  1. 浏览器兼容性:大多数现代浏览器都支持标准的颜色代码格式,但一些旧版本的浏览器可能不支持某些颜色名称或格式。
  2. 设备兼容性:不同的设备(如手机、平板、电脑)可能对颜色的显示效果有所不同,尤其是在显示色域有限的情况下。
  3. 解决方案:为了确保颜色代码在不同设备和浏览器上的兼容性,可以使用Web安全色,或者使用CSS的@media查询来根据不同的设备设置不同的颜色代码。

通过以上几个方面的介绍,相信你已经对HTML中的颜色代码有了更深入的了解,在实际应用中,选择合适的颜色代码可以帮助你更好地设计网页,提升用户体验。

html中颜色代码

其他相关扩展阅读资料参考文献:

颜色代码的表示方式

  1. 十六进制(HEX):HTML中最常用的格式,以开头,后跟6位十六进制字符(如#FF5733),代表红、绿、蓝三色的强度。
  2. RGB函数:通过rgb(255, 100, 50)指定颜色,数值范围0-255,可精确控制颜色成分,支持RGB和RGBA(加透明度)。
  3. HSL函数:使用hsl(30, 70%, 50%)定义颜色,参数分别为色相(0-360度)、饱和度(0%-100%)、亮度(0%-100%),适合动态调整颜色。
  4. 预定义颜色名称:HTML支持如redblue等名称,简洁但色值选择有限,适合快速开发。
  5. 透明度处理:RGBA或HSLA格式可添加透明度值(0-1),实现半透明效果,如rgba(255, 0, 0, 0.5)

颜色代码的应用场景

  1. 网页设计基础:背景色、文字颜色、边框颜色等元素均通过颜色代码实现,如<body style="background-color: #FFFFFF;">
  2. 数据可视化:图表颜色需区分数据类别,建议使用对比度高的色值(如#FF0000#00FF00),避免视觉混淆。
  3. 表单样式优化:输入框和按钮的交互状态(如悬停、聚焦)可通过颜色代码动态变化,提升用户体验。
  4. 品牌标识匹配:企业LOGO或主题色需严格遵循品牌色值,例如#007BFF(蓝色)常用于科技类网站。
  5. 响应式设计适配:在媒体查询中调整颜色代码,确保不同设备上颜色表现一致,如@media (max-width: 768px) { background-color: #000000; }

颜色代码的生成与选择工具

  1. 在线颜色生成器:如Coolors或Adobe Color,可快速生成配色方案并复制HTML代码,节省手动计算时间。
  2. 代码编辑器插件:VS Code的“Color Picker”插件支持点击颜色选择,直接生成HEX或RGB代码,提高开发效率。
  3. 设计软件导出:Figma、Sketch等工具可导出精确的颜色代码,确保设计稿与前端实现一致。
  4. 浏览器开发者工具:通过“元素检查器”查看网页元素的颜色值,便于调试和学习。
  5. 代码转换工具:将HEX转换为RGB或HSL的工具(如W3C颜色转换器)可避免格式错误,确保代码兼容性。

颜色代码的注意事项

html中颜色代码
  1. 兼容性验证:避免使用过于生僻的色值(如#00FF00在部分浏览器中可能显示异常),优先选择标准色值。
  2. 性能优化:大量使用颜色代码可能导致渲染延迟,建议通过CSS变量统一管理颜色,减少重复代码。
  3. 可访问性设计:确保颜色对比度符合WCAG标准(如文字与背景色的对比度至少为4.5:1),避免色盲用户阅读困难。
  4. 代码规范统一:保持颜色代码格式一致(如统一使用HEX或RGB),便于团队协作和后期维护。
  5. 动态调整技巧:通过CSS变量(如--primary-color: #FF5733;)定义颜色,可在一处修改并影响全站样式,提升灵活性。

颜色代码的进阶技巧

  1. 渐变色实现:使用linear-gradient()函数结合颜色代码,如background: linear-gradient(#FF5733, #007BFF);,增强视觉层次。
  2. 阴影效果优化:通过box-shadow属性指定颜色代码,如box-shadow: 5px 5px 10px #888888;,提升元素立体感。
  3. 动态颜色生成:利用JavaScript根据用户输入或环境变量实时生成颜色代码,如document.body.style.backgroundColor = "#"+Math.floor(Math.random()*16777215).toString(16);
  4. 主题切换功能:通过切换CSS变量中的颜色值(如--primary-color#FF5733变为#007BFF),实现暗色/亮色模式切换。
  5. 响应式配色策略:根据屏幕尺寸调整颜色代码,例如在移动端使用高对比度色值(如#000000#FFFFFF),确保可读性。


颜色代码是HTML开发中不可或缺的工具,掌握其表示方式和应用场景能显著提升网页设计效率,无论是初学者还是资深开发者,都应关注兼容性、可访问性等细节,同时善用生成工具和进阶技巧,如渐变色、动态调整等,让颜色在网页中发挥最大价值。合理选择颜色代码格式,结合实际需求灵活运用,才能打造既美观又实用的网页界面。

html中颜色代码

扫描二维码推送至手机访问。

版权声明:本文由码界编程网发布,如需转载请注明出处。

本文链接:http://b2b.dropc.cn/xxfs/17107.html

分享给朋友:

“html中颜色代码,HTML颜色代码全解析” 的相关文章

jquery js,深入解析,jQuery与JavaScript的完美融合

jquery js,深入解析,jQuery与JavaScript的完美融合

jQuery是一个快速、小型且功能丰富的JavaScript库,它简化了HTML文档遍历、事件处理、动画和Ajax交互的操作,通过使用jQuery,开发者可以更高效地编写跨浏览器的JavaScript代码,减少重复劳动,并通过简洁的语法实现复杂的功能,它广泛用于网页开发,以增强用户体验和网站动态性。...

源代码索拉卡,源代码中的索拉卡解析

源代码索拉卡,源代码中的索拉卡解析

源代码索拉卡是一款基于源代码的索拉卡游戏,玩家可以在游戏中扮演索拉卡,与其他玩家进行对战,游戏采用独特的源代码机制,让玩家通过编写代码来控制索拉卡,实现各种战斗策略,游戏画面精美,操作简单,适合所有年龄段的玩家。 大家好,我是游戏《英雄联盟》的忠实玩家,最近我发现了一个非常有趣的话题——“源代码索...

织梦网预约模板,织梦网预约模板,轻松打造个性化预约页面

织梦网预约模板,织梦网预约模板,轻松打造个性化预约页面

织梦网预约模板是一款方便用户在线预约的服务工具,用户可通过该模板轻松创建预约页面,包括预约时间、服务项目、预约人信息等,模板设计简洁美观,操作便捷,适用于各类预约场景,如美容美发、教育培训、医疗咨询等,通过织梦网预约模板,用户可提高预约效率,提升服务品质。 我最近在使用织梦网预约模板,感觉真的挺方...

html如何设置字体颜色,HTML字体颜色设置指南

html如何设置字体颜色,HTML字体颜色设置指南

在HTML中设置字体颜色可以通过`标签的color属性或CSS样式来实现,使用标签时,直接在标签内添加color属性并指定颜色值,如红色文字,若使用CSS,则需在标签内定义.class或#id选择器,并设置color属性,.myFont { color: red; },然后给相应元素添加类名或ID,...

textarea文本域,探索 textarea 文本域的强大功能与应用

textarea文本域,探索 textarea 文本域的强大功能与应用

textarea文本域是一个强大的输入控件,允许用户输入多行文本,它广泛应用于网页表单中,用于收集用户的长篇评论、笔记或信息,textarea的强大功能包括自定义高度和宽度、限制字符数、只读属性以及富文本编辑等,通过灵活配置,textarea能够满足不同场景下的文本输入需求,提升用户体验,本文将深入...

利用vlookup函数给出单价,VLOOKUP函数应用,轻松获取商品单价

利用vlookup函数给出单价,VLOOKUP函数应用,轻松获取商品单价

本文介绍了如何使用Excel中的VLOOKUP函数来查找并获取商品的单价,VLOOKUP函数通过指定查找的列、查找值以及结果返回的列,能够快速从数据表中检索到对应商品的单价信息,通过设置精确匹配,用户可以确保查找结果准确无误,从而提高数据处理的效率。VLOOKUP函数——轻松获取商品单价 大家好,...